Skip to main content
Skip to footer
Home
>
California
>
San Diego
>
Supercuts
Supercuts
Rated 4.1 with 159 reviews
Barber shops
Beauty Parlours
Beauty salons
Hair salons
Waxing hair removal services
Find this stylist
Address
7970 University Ave #300, La Mesa, CA 91942
Phone
(619) 469-9646